WebOur basement design expert will inspect and measure your basement, consider all your expectations and ideas, present you with your options and guide you through the process … WebDec 1, 2024 · Basement finishing costs about $7 to $23 per square foot, so the larger the space, the more you’ll spend to turn it into a cozy den or welcoming guest suite. A smaller, 500-square-foot basement will cost about $3,500 to $11,500 total, while a large, 1,500-square-foot basement will cost $10,500 to $34,500 to finish.
